The Age of the Patriarchs -- A Nation Is Born -- Israel in the Land -- The Fall of Israel and Judah – Prophecy -- Exile and Return -- The Hellenistic Period -- Under Roman Dominion -- The Rise of Christianity -- New Centers of Diaspora -- The Age of Islam -- The Jews in Europe to 1492 -- New Centers of Jewish Settlement -- Mysticism and Messianism -- The Dawn of Emancipation -- Anti-Semitism and Migrations -- Nationalism, Assimilation, Zionism -- World War I and the Balfour Declaration -- Palestine Between the Wars -- The Holocaust -- Israel Is Born -- American Jewry in the Twentieth Century -- The Jewish World Today
My people is a story-epic, splendid, and infinitely moving-of a small people unique from any other, whose history has had a profound influence on the entire human condition. The book relives the drama of Abraham-the time of the first covenant; the giving of the law of Moses; the Prophetic vision; the terrifying march of the Roman legions; the haunting shadows of exile; the brilliance of the Enlightenment; the unparalleled agony of Auschwitz; and the victorious renewal of a birthright. Many civilizations march across its pages: Canaanite, Assyrian, Greek, Roman, Christian, Arab, European, American, up to the founding of modern Israel, which stands in the center of the Jewish world today. Abba Eban tells this majestic story as a scholar, philosopher, and historian. MY PEOPLE reflects the vision, the fact, and the myth which comprise the life and thought of the Jewish people.
